Question Daewoo DSC-3220

We just picked up a new TV in Argos' "20% off Widescreen TVs" sale, it's a Daewoo DSC-3220 32" 100Hz widescreen TV. The problem we're having is that when things like text appear on the screen, they seem to be a bit blurred - for example, we were watching a tennis match on British Eurosport where they had the name of the tennis ground printed on the court, and while it was fine on our older 4:3 TV it appeared a bit blurry/harder to read on the new TV. We tried fiddling with some of the things in the menu, but nothing seemed to help. I've also tried searching on the internet but can't find out how to get into the service menu. Can anyone help?
